Blake Lively Shares Her Baby Registry Must-Haves
“Before I had my own kids, I asked all the parents I trusted most for a list of their ‘go-to’ items. My registry is made of all those products plus ones that I’ve discovered myself over the years,” the mom-of-three told People. “The neat part is I actually keep this registry active for years, because it’s an easy way for me to reorder all our basics, and it’s also a great way to share my ‘must-have’ list with my friends, as they did with me when I needed it. The baby registry is a community tool for me more than anything else.”

The list includes items like Honest Company Diapers, WaterWipes, Ergobaby Carrier, Baby Jogger City Mini Double Stroller, reusable food storage bags, Halo Bassinet Swivel Sleeper, SwaddleMe Swaddles, Dr. Brown’s Baby Bottles, and Milkmakers Lactation Cookie Bites.
The actress is working with Amazon to donate to the Child Rescue Coalition, an “organization that is doing such important work in protecting our children worldwide.”
